Burial Insurance: Best Way to Protect Your Loved Ones Life is full of uncertainties, and while we may not like to think about it, planning for the future is essential— especially when it comes to protecting our loved ones from unexpected financial burdens. Burial insurance, also known as final expense insurance, is designed to cover the costs associated with end-of-life expenses, ensuring that your family does not have to bear the financial strain during an already difficult time. What is Burial Insurance? Burial insurance is a type of life insurance policy that provides a payout to cover funeral costs, medical bills, outstanding debts, and other final expenses. These policies are typically smaller in coverage amounts compared to traditional life insurance, often ranging between $5,000 and $25,000, making them an affordable option for many individuals. Why Consider Burial Insurance? 1.Financial Security for Your Family– The average funeral can cost between $7,000 and $12,000, including services, burial, or cremation. Burial insurance helps ensure that your family isn’t left struggling with these costs. 2.Simple Qualification Process– Many burial insurance policies do not require a medical exam, making them accessible to older adults or those with health concerns. 3.Peace of Mind– Knowing that your final expenses are covered allows you to focus on enjoying life without worrying about leaving a financial burden behind. 4.Quick Payouts– Unlike some traditional life insurance policies, burial insurance often provides a faster payout to beneficiaries, ensuring funds are available when needed. How to Choose the Right Policy When selecting a burial insurance policy, consider the following: Coverage Amount– Estimate the total costs of funeral expenses, medical bills, and any other outstanding debts to determine the appropriate coverage. Premium Costs– Compare premiums from different providers to find a plan that fits within your budget. Policy Type– Decide between a simplified issue policy (no medical exam, just a health questionnaire) or a guaranteed issue policy (no health questions, but higher premiums). Reputable Insurer– Choose a company with a strong financial rating and a history of reliable customer service.
